The Numbers Game - Drinking Game Rules & How to Play
The Numbers Game is a drinking game in the No Equipment category for 4-15 players that takes about 15-25 min with a medium difficulty level.

Setup
Grab your drinks and form a seated circle with all players within earshot of one another. Decide on a starting player, and agree on the counting direction (clockwise or counterclockwise). Make sure everyone understands the specific substitutions: say 'buzz' for any number containing 7, clap for multiples of 7, and 'fizz' for any number containing 3. Drink of choice should be on-hand for penalties.
How to Play The Numbers Game
- Count around the circle
- Replace 7s with 'buzz'
- Replace multiples of 7 with clap
- Replace numbers with 3 with 'fizz'
- Multiple rules can stack
- Wrong action = drink
- Hesitate = drink
- Gets faster each round
Tips & Strategies
Start slow for the first round so everyone gets used to the rules. When rules start stacking, focus on the clapping rule since it's the easiest to slip up on during faster rounds. If you're unsure whether a number qualifies for multiple substitutions, say the sequence in your head once before speaking,you'll avoid that dreaded hesitation penalty. Don't forget: if someone says 'buzz' when they should clap, call them out immediately.

Frequently Asked Questions
- What happens if a number is both a multiple of 7 and contains a 3?
- Both rules apply. For example, 21 would require you to clap for the multiple of 7 and say 'fizz' for the 3.
- Can someone sit out if they mess up too much?
- Not typically. The game usually continues with everyone playing, but you can add a house rule to let someone tap out after a certain number of drinks if needed.
- What if two people call out actions at the same time?
- The group decides who was right and who hesitated or made the mistake. The wrong or slower person drinks.
- What happens if the counting reaches triple digits?
- The game gets even trickier! All rules still apply, so keep track of numbers like 137 (buzz for the 7) or 231 (fizz for the 3).
